About the role

We are looking for a Field Robotics Software & Communications Engineer (m/f/d) to ensure our robotic platforms operate reliably in real-world environments. You will be the technical point of contact during field deployments, customer demonstrations, military exercises, and integration campaigns. Your focus: software interfaces, controller configuration, radio/LTE/satellite communications, and troubleshooting directly in the field.

You bridge the gap between engineering and operations - ensuring that our systems communicate, perform, and integrate flawlessly in demanding environments.

Key Responsibilities

  • Deploy, configure, and test ARX robotic platforms at customer sites, training grounds, and field exercises;
  • Set up, validate, and troubleshoot communication systems including:
    • Tactical radios & encrypted communication devices;
    • LTE/5G modems and network routing;
    • Satellite (Starlink) terminals and satcom setups.
  • Configure and maintain controller software, mission interfaces, and communication protocols for stable field operation;
  • Integrate sensors, payloads, and external systems using APIs, SDKs, and data interfaces;
  • Diagnose software, networking, and communication issues directly in the field - under time pressure and operational constraints;
  • Support customers and users on-site: training, operational assistance, scenario support;
  • Collect field feedback, identify technical improvements, and work with the engineering team to implement fixes;
  • Prepare documentation, network diagrams, field test reports, and integration notes;
  • Participate in testing campaigns, experiments, and product validation in realistic environments.

Your Profile

  • Degree in Computer Science, Robotics,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ics or related — or equivalent hands-on technical experience;
  • Strong software and communication systems knowledge, ideally in robotics or unmanned systems;
  • Solid experience with:
    • ROS/ROS2 or similar robotics frameworks;
    • Embedded Linux, microcontrollers, C++/Python scripting;
    • Networking fundamentals (TCP/UDP, routing, VPN, antenna setups, QoS).
  • Practical experience working with radios, LTE/5G devices, satellite communication or secure tactical communication equipment;
  • Ability to troubleshoot complex system behavior in the field across software, communications, and hardware boundaries;
  • Comfortable working outdoors, at training ranges, industrial facilities, military exercises, and customer sites;
  • Strong communication skills for training, on-site support, and customer interaction;
  • Willingness to travel frequently (Germany + EU);
  • Fluent in English; German is a plus;
  • Hands-on, proactive mindset - someone who enjoys being “out there” solving real operational problems.
